Share your testimony
My earliest memories of school are from when i attended Trinity Lutheran School in Port Huron, MI. I was a student from Kindergarten until fifth grade when our family moved. Throughout junior high and high school, church was not important to me; I didn't attend nor did I feel that church had the answers. Upon my high school commencement, I left for Boot camp with the US Air Force. I bought my first Bible while there, an NLT. It made a great mantle piece after I left Basic Training. While stationed at Kadena AB, Japan, I found interest in Buddhism. I took much time to study and immerse myself in this sacred region's religion. Although Buddhism is peaceful and the doctrines represent sound moral examples, I was still lost. Shortly after the birth of my son, my then fiance' suggested that we attend church so that our boys could grow up knowing that God loved them and that they wouldn't be alone. I politely informed her that I felt as though a church "would burn down as soon as I set foot inside the building." We attended a few services with some different churches and finally found our home at Griswold Street Baptist Church. That was three years ago. Today we are one of two "leader" couples for the church's Young Couple's Ministry. God also is glorifying himself through me by beginning a Men's Ministry in which I will be the facilitator. Praise God for his grace and mercy even though we don't deserve his salvation, nor love.
